Output 50d8ca8b397763c791da0ac57c1b445a77319b34a1f9c15fb0b060f48f93c6ba:9

value
860379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57baa5f265f87bd011308c964054187c0d08bce2 OP_EQUAL
address
39gtJnA4PFGTLM2bgRjt1zuAEQk4j2MFqR
transaction
50d8ca8b397763c791da0ac57c1b445a77319b34a1f9c15fb0b060f48f93c6ba
spent
true